I respect Faf du Plessis’s authority as captain, he believes in himself: Virat Kohli

Royal Challengers Bangalore star Virat Kohli, while speaking on his equation with skipper Faf du Plessis, said that he respects the authority that the former South Africa skipper has as a leader of former finalists. Kohli said du Plessis does say no to his suggestions from time to time and he respects the opener for his belief.

Virat Kohli stepped down as the captain of RCB after the end of IPL 2022. After months of speculation, RCB appointed him the captain of the franchise after buying Faf du Plessis in the IPL mega auction in February.

Faf du Plessis has led RCB in his own style, lauding the cooperative leadership and the presence of experienced chiefs in the dressing room. The star batsman has also been among the runs, scoring 389 runs in 12 matches so far, including 3 fifties.

Virat Kohli said lightly, “Faf (du Plessis) and I have always been good friends, even when he was the captain of South Africa. Faf is someone who believes in himself and has a good hand on the field. have every right.” Chat with presenter Danish Sait on RCB Insider.

“He sometimes tells me, if I mention things, that he doesn’t want to do that, which I respect a lot. That only gives you respect for the person you’re playing under.”

Meanwhile, Kohli also hinted that AB de Villiers may return to RCB in some coaching capacity next year. De Villiers, who was an integral member of RCB’s team for years, retired from all forms of cricket last year.

De Villiers stayed away from the game and Kohli revealed that the former South African batsman was recently in the United States, enjoying some golfing action.

He said, “I miss him a lot. I talk to him regularly. He was recently in America watching golf with his family…

Kohli is going through the leanest patch of his cricketing career, scoring just 129 runs in 12 matches, which includes 3 golden ducks.

However, RCB are in the race for the playoffs with 7 wins in their first 12 matches.
